Your At-Home Blood Sugar Test: A Step-by-Step Guide to Using a Glucose Meter
Managing diabetes effectively often involves regular at-home blood sugar testing. Using a glucose meter allows you to monitor your blood glucose levels, helping you make informed decisions about your diet, exercise, and medication. This comprehensive guide will provide you with a step-by-step process for performing an accurate at-home blood sugar test.

Essential Supplies for At-Home Blood Sugar Testing
Before you begin, gather the following supplies:
- Glucose Meter: A device that measures the glucose level in your blood.
- Test Strips: Specifically designed for your glucose meter model.
- Lancet Device: A device used to prick your finger to obtain a blood sample.
- Lancets: Small, sterile needles that fit into the lancing device.
- Alcohol Swabs: To clean the fingertip before testing.
- Cotton Ball or Gauze Pad: To stop any bleeding after the test.
- Sharps Container: For safely disposing of used lancets.
Step-by-Step Guide to Using a Glucose Meter
Follow these steps for an accurate at-home blood sugar test:
- Wash Your Hands: Thoroughly wash your hands with soap and warm water. This removes dirt and contaminants that can affect the results. Dry your hands completely.
- Prepare the Lancing Device: Insert a new lancet into the lancing device according to the manufacturer's instructions. Adjust the depth setting on the device if needed (usually higher for thicker skin).
- Insert the Test Strip: Insert a new test strip into the glucose meter. The meter will typically turn on automatically or require a button press, depending on the model.
- Select a Finger: Choose a fingertip on either hand, preferably on the side rather than directly on the pad. Avoid using the same finger repeatedly.
- Clean the Finger: Wipe the selected fingertip with an alcohol swab and allow it to air dry completely.
- Prick Your Finger: Place the lancing device firmly against the cleaned fingertip and press the release button to prick your finger.
- Obtain a Blood Sample: Gently squeeze or massage your finger (starting from the base of the finger towards the fingertip) to encourage a small drop of blood to form. Avoid milking the finger too forcefully.
- Apply the Blood Sample: Carefully touch the edge of the test strip to the blood drop. The strip will automatically draw the blood into the testing area. Ensure enough blood is applied to the strip according to the meter's instructions.
- Wait for the Results: The glucose meter will display your blood sugar reading after a few seconds. Note the result and the time of the test.
- Stop the Bleeding: Apply pressure to the pricked fingertip with a clean cotton ball or gauze pad until the bleeding stops.
- Dispose of the Lancet: Safely dispose of the used lancet in a sharps container. Never reuse lancets.
Interpreting Your Blood Sugar Results
Once you have your blood sugar reading, it's essential to understand what it means.
Here are general target ranges for blood sugar levels:
- Before Meals (Fasting): 80-130 mg/dL
- 2 Hours After Meals: Less than 180 mg/dL
These ranges are general guidelines and might be different based on individual factors. Your healthcare provider will provide personalized target ranges for your specific needs.
Factors That Can Affect Your Blood Sugar Readings
Several factors can influence your blood sugar readings:

- Food: Carbohydrate intake, especially sugary foods and drinks, can cause blood sugar spikes.
- Exercise: Physical activity can lower blood sugar levels.
- Medications: Insulin and other diabetes medications directly affect blood sugar.
- Stress: Stress can increase blood sugar levels due to hormone release.
- Illness: Infections and illnesses can raise blood sugar.
- Hydration: Dehydration can affect blood sugar concentrations.
- Time of Day: Blood sugar levels can naturally fluctuate throughout the day.
- Expired Test Strips: Using expired test strips can lead to inaccurate results.
- Improper Meter Calibration: Ensure your meter is properly calibrated.
- Contaminated Skin: Food or other substances on your skin can contaminate the sample.
Troubleshooting Common Issues
- No Blood Sample: If you're unable to get a sufficient blood sample, try using a deeper lancet setting, warming your hands, or massaging your finger more gently.
- Error Messages: Consult your glucose meter's user manual for instructions on how to troubleshoot specific error messages.
- Inconsistent Results: If you're getting consistently inaccurate readings, double-check the expiration date of your test strips, ensure your meter is calibrated correctly, and contact your healthcare provider or meter manufacturer for assistance.
- Pain During Testing: If you experience excessive pain, try using a different lancing site or a lancing device with adjustable depth settings.
Advanced Blood Sugar Monitoring Options
Beyond traditional glucose meters, other technologies are available for blood sugar monitoring:
- Continuous Glucose Monitors (CGMs): CGMs continuously track glucose levels throughout the day and night, providing real-time data and trends.
- Flash Glucose Monitoring Systems: Flash monitors require you to scan a sensor to obtain a glucose reading.
These advanced technologies can offer more comprehensive insights into your blood sugar patterns, but they may not be suitable for everyone. Discuss these options with your healthcare provider.
Tips for Accurate and Consistent Testing
- Always Use Fresh Test Strips: Expired test strips can give inaccurate results.
- Store Test Strips Properly: Keep them in their original container, away from heat and moisture.
- Calibrate Your Meter Regularly: Follow the manufacturer's instructions for calibration.
- Keep a Log: Track your blood sugar readings, food intake, exercise, and medications to identify patterns.
- Discuss Results with Your Doctor: Regularly review your blood sugar logs with your healthcare provider to adjust your treatment plan as needed.
- Maintain Your Equipment: Regularly clean your glucose meter per the manufacturer's guidelines.
Understanding Blood Sugar Levels: An HTML Table
To better understand the implications of different blood sugar ranges, here is a table summarizing the levels:
Blood Sugar Level (mg/dL) | Interpretation | Potential Actions |
---|---|---|
Below 70 (Hypoglycemia) | Low blood sugar; requires immediate attention. | Consume fast-acting carbohydrates (e.g., glucose tablets, juice), recheck in 15 minutes. |
80-130 (Fasting Target) | Normal fasting blood sugar range for many individuals with diabetes. | Maintain current diet and medication plan. |
130-180 (Post-Meal Target) | Acceptable post-meal blood sugar range for many individuals with diabetes. | Continue monitoring and make adjustments as needed with the guidance of your doctor. |
Above 180 (Hyperglycemia) | High blood sugar; needs monitoring and potential intervention. | Drink water, avoid sugary foods, consider adjustments to insulin/medication, consult with healthcare provider if persistently high. |
